KANCHEEPURAM: The Kanchipuram Handloom Silk and Lace Saree Manufacturers’ Association has urged the State government to expand the domain earmarked for usage of Geographical Index mark for Kancheepuram silk saris.
At present, products manufactured by handloom weavers residing in Kancheepuram municipal area alone are considered as Kancheepuram silk saris under the GI mark regulations. But, thousands of weavers are living in nearby rural areas , association president Y.M. Narayanasamy told reporters recently. The recession suffered by the industry in the last decade and urbanisation that swept the town during that period had forced the weavers shift their residence-cum-weaving units to nearby rural local body areas.
In order to save the silk sari weaving community, the association had suggested that villages located within 15 km radius from Kancheepuram town limit should be included in Geographical Index mark domain, he said.
